pero no me genera el ejecutable
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.
Mostrar Mensajes MenúCita de: CrisQC en 18 Agosto 2011, 05:41 AM
Bien. No es necesario pitagoras, te explico genéricamente como:
- Tenés una imagen( IMG0 ) con un ancho y un alto, que además tiene una posición en X y en Y.
- Tenés otra imagen( IMG1 ) con las mismas características.
¿ Como saber si colisionaron ?
- Hay que averiguar si IMG1 coincide en algún punto con IMG0.if( IMG1.x > IMG0.x && IMG1.x < ( IMG0.x + IMG0.width ) )
{
if( IMG1.y > IMG0.y && IMG1.y < ( IMG0.y + IMG0.width ) )
{
// hay una colisión
}
}
Esto podrías ponerlo en una función para facilitarlo y solo le pasas los elementos que quieras evaluar.